Broiling pans are special low, flat pans that come with North American stoves to help with broiling food. Many stoves come with a two-part broiling pan designed to fit nicely into a designated broiling space.
Is a broiler pan the same as a roasting pan?
A broiling pan’s main use is to cook food under extremely high temperatures, with the heat directed from the top of the oven. Roasters are also designed for high temperatures but with the heat rising from the bottom of the oven instead of the top.
What is the tray in an oven called?
A sheet pan, baking tray or baking sheet is a flat, rectangular metal pan used in an oven. It is often used for baking bread rolls, pastries and flat products such as cookies, sheet cakes, Swiss rolls and pizzas.

What does a roasting pan look like?
A roasting pan is a large, high sided pan, typically with removable racks and/or a ribbed bottom and handles. And yes, you do need one, or something like it, if you plan on cooking whole turkeys or large cuts of meat in the oven.

Article first time published onWhat size is sheet pan?
Quarter sheet pans are typically 9 by 13 inches (a standard size for sheet cakes), half sheet pans are 18 by 13 inches (this is the size of most pans described simply as baking sheets) and full sheet pans are 26 by 18 inches (too big to fit in many home ovens, but the standard commercial size).
What are oven trays made of?
Baking trays are usually made of aluminum or steel. Some models are coated with non-stick surfacing. The sides may be rimmed, or completely open (in which case they are, as discussed above, “baking sheets.”)

What does a broil pan look like?
A broiler pan is a pan specially designed to use in the oven for broiling. It comes in two pieces, a slotted upper pan and a deeper, solid lower pan called a drip pan. Broiling allows food, such as meats, to be cooked at extremely high temperatures with a direct heat typically coming from above rather than below.

Is broiling the same as grilling?
You may be contemplating the question is broiling the same as grilling. Broiling and grilling do have a cooking process that’s similar. However, grilling has a heat source that’s below the food, and the heat source for broiling is above the food. Both types of cooking methods use direct heat.

What is hotel pan?
Hotel pans are food pans used for food storage, holding and serving. They are used in many facets of the restaurant and catering industries. Hotel pans sometimes referred to as “steam table pans,” “service pans” or “counter pans.” As you might imagine, hotel pans are often used in steam tables to hold food for serving.

What's the difference between broil and bake?
Broiling uses only top-down heat to completely cook delicate food or just crisp and brown the top of already-cooked dishes. Baking uses moderate temperatures to cook food. Heating elements on the top, bottom and sometimes the back of the oven are used for an all-over cooking method.
Do you leave the oven door open when you broil?
The normal practice is to leave the oven door slightly ajar. This allows heat to escape and forces the broil element to stay on rather than cycling off and on. Open door broiling is good for when you are broiling for short periods of time, like cooking thinner meats, top browning or searing meat.

Is aluminum cookware safe?
Our science editor reports that the consensus in the medical community is that using aluminum cookware poses no health threat. In short: While untreated aluminum is not unsafe, it should not be used with acidic foods, which may ruin both the food and the cookware.
What type of pan is best for baking?
Glass pans let you see how done your food is, too. Metal baking pans, whether aluminum or steel, conduct heat more efficiently so food cooks more quickly in them. Stainless steel is the material of choice for pros, but stainless steel pans don’t have a nonstick coating, so it takes longer to prepare them for baking.
